Abstract:Prediction and control of steel microstructure during continuous casting process is an essential task for steel production. Studies on the micro- structural parameters, which are hardly measured directly during high temperature solidification process, have significance for that purpose. Dendrite growth is an important phenomenon during steel solidification process, which is the main existing style in the inner side of the solidifying steel. In the current paper, a simplified numerical method for the dendrite growth was used to analyze and calculate some micro- structural parameters for both medium carbon steel and AISI304 type stainless steels under different casting conditions. The dendrite tip radius, dendrite growth velocity, dendrite arm spacing, temperature gradient and the dendrite tip temperature in the front of solid and liquid interface were investigated and comparisons of these parameters for the two steel grades were carried out. Parametric studies for these two steel grades were also studied. The comparisons showed that the micro- structural parameter values of stainless steel were all smaller than that of the carbon steel due to its special compositions and solidification mode characteristics.
